site stats

Diff between useref and usestate

WebSep 8, 2024 · useState. useState allows you to make components stateful. In older React to do so, it required using a class component. Hooks give the ability to write it using just functions. This allows us to have more flexible components. In the example component below, every time the user clicks on the h1, it’ll change colours. WebMay 11, 2024 · useState와 useRef 모두 상태관리를 위해 사용할 수 있습니다. 다만 useState의 경우 state변화 후에 re-rendering을 진행하는 반면 useRef는 진행하지 않습니다. 이러한 특성에 맞추어 렌더링이 필요한 state의 경우에는 useState를 사용하며 그렇지 않은 경우 useRef를 사용하는 것이...

useRef vs useState on React Hook Component - YouTube

WebRun Example ». useRef () only returns one item. It returns an Object called current. When we initialize useRef we set the initial value: useRef (0). It's like doing this: const count = {current: 0}. We can access the count by using count.current. Run this on your computer … WebJan 14, 2024 · The difference is that: useMemo does not cause a re-render, while useState does; useMemo only runs when its dependencies (if any) have changed, while setSomeState (second array item returned by useState) does not have such a dependency array; Both useMemo and useEffect only runs when their dependencies change (if any). … chris daughtry ticketmaster https://lixingprint.com

The Difference Between useState and useRef in React - Medium

WebAug 11, 2024 · React Hooks — useState, useEffect, useRef, useMemo (TicTacToe Game) Picture this : You have an excellent function component in your app, but one day you need to add a lifecycle method in it. After a moment you think, you can convert function component into a class & there you go. WebSep 6, 2024 · Hooks like useState employ some magic under-the-hood to avoid the re-render problem. That’s great, and it seems simple enough using useState, but what about when you need to do things outside of setting state? Enter useEffect. Gone are those … Web1 day ago · The lag comes exactly when I release my finger from the screen, and the Animated.timing starts. It stops for a moment. See the gif. I attach the code block too, I added the state change to row 27, marked. import React, { useRef, useState } from "react"; import { Animated, Dimensions, PanResponder, View } from "react-native"; import … gentek black aluminum soffit

useRef vs useState – It

Category:Accessing previous props or state with React Hooks

Tags:Diff between useref and usestate

Diff between useref and usestate

useState vs. useRef : Similarities, differences, and use cases

WebMar 16, 2024 · useRef() is a hook that is used to persist value between the renders. It returns a reference to the object that contains a property name as "current". As you can see below the declaration of useRef() hook and how to update the current property in the ref … Web1 day ago · How can I preserve the state of the editor and the history without useState, i.e. prevent the creation of a new instance of the editor every time the overaly is triggered? This is vanilla create-react-app .

Diff between useref and usestate

Did you know?

WebuseState is a reactive hook which returns you a value and a setValue function and it’s not mentioned to directly mutate the returned value but use the function to mutate instead. This method will provoke changes in react lifecycle 1.1K views View upvotes Answer requested by Mohammad Akter Hossain 2 Boarma Boarma WebMar 2, 2024 · The useRef hook. The hook useRef is a bit similar to useState, it returns an object that has a property current inside which we can access using object dot notation. That property current takes the …

WebMar 13, 2024 · The difference between the useRef hook and the createRef function is that the useRef hook holds its value between re-renders in a function component. The existing ref persists between re-renders. createRef is used to create a ref and a new ref is created during each render. import React, { createRef, useEffect, useState } from "react"; export ...

WebOct 3, 2024 · useRef as an alternative to useState. But we can use useRef as an alternative to useState. When we update a state with useState, it triggers a re-rendering. For example, when I change a state ‘A ... WebNov 25, 2024 · It seems that the React.useState implementation is easier than the React.useRef one. We are using the component state and this means that the component was refreshed a bunch of times — in fact, the console log prints the ### Refreshing string more than 60 times.. If you wrote a big component with other nested components without …

WebOct 3, 2024 · useState is a hook which is used to update the state in functional component. useRef is a hook which provides a way to access to the DOM.

WebApr 6, 2024 · 3. forwardRef () in TypeScript. Using forwardRef () in TypeScript is a bit trickier because you have to indicate the type arguments of useRef () in the parent component and forwardRef () wrapping the child component. Both functions are generic function types. forwardRef () accepts 2 argument types: gen tek bluetooth earbuds tw3WebOct 28, 2024 · And this makes sense! useState should be used when the value of state should affect what gets rendered. useRef should be used when you want to have a piece of information that persists “for the full lifetime of the component” - not just during its render … chris daughtry time of my life lyricsWebApr 11, 2024 · 3. useRef for Data Binding. n React, useRef is commonly used to store a reference to a DOM node or a value that persists between renders. However, it can also be used to perform data binding, where a component’s state is updated based on the current value of an input field. Here’s an example of using useRef for data binding: chris daughtry ticketsWebTo use the useState Hook, we first need to import it into our component. Example: Get your own React.js Server. At the top of your component, import the useState Hook. import { useState } from "react"; Notice that we are destructuring useState from react as it is a … gen tek bluetooth earbuds tw2WebMar 14, 2024 · useState is a basic Hook for managing simple state transformation, and useReducer is an additional Hook for managing more complex state logic. However, it’s worth noting that useState uses useReducer internally, implying that you could use useReducer for everything you can do with useState. chris daughtry the masked singerWebOct 14, 2024 · useRef and useState hook also have different syntaxes: 1 const reference = useRef (initialValue); The useRef hook is mutable, it returns a mutable ref object, so initialValue can be updated without it affecting the React lifecycle. 1 const [value, setValue] = … gentek building productsWebNov 10, 2024 · useState returns 2 properties or an array. One is the value or state and the other is the function to update the state. In contrast, useRef returns only one value which is the actual data stored. When the … gen tek bluetooth headphones tw3